In Vitro and In Vivo Establishment of Pasteurella Haemolytica A2 in the Lungs of Goats
Pneumonic pasteurellosis is an important respiratory disease of sheep and goats throughout the world. It is mainly caused by Pasteurella haemolytica even though Pasteurella multocida has occasionally been associated with the same disease.
